In this week's episode, Emily talks about how she pictures her life after graduating from high school, diving deep into raising kids, marriage and college. The future has always been something that she gave a lot of thought to, worrying about whether or not, her way of living would be considered "successful" in societal norms. Do you need to follow the structure that was given to us by society? Does everyone only have that one soulmate that you're supposed to spend the rest of your life with? Is letting your child not go out very often okay? And do you really need to invite your family members that you dislike to your wedding?
